问题描述:
示例1.
输入:[-4,-1,0,3,10]
输出:[0,1,9,16,100]
示例2.
输入:[-7,-3,2,3,11]
输出:[4,9,9,49,121]
思路:
for循环遍历原数组,将A[i]*=A[i];
再排序数组即可
java代码
class Solution {
public int[] sortedSquares(int[] A) {
for(int i=0;i<A.length;i++){
A[i]*=A[i];
}
Arrays.sort(A);
return A;
}
}